Harel Takes Aim At Tremblay's Job -- Montreal Gazette
The jury is still out on whether Louise Harel will hurt or help Vision Montreal party’s chances of winning power at city hall in the Nov. 1 municipal election.
But as Montrealers take in yesterday’s announcement that Vision Montreal leader Benoit Labonté is stepping aside to allow Harel, the former Parti Québécois cabinet minister who oversaw the forced municipal mergers, to run as his party’s mayoral candidate against Mayor Gérald Tremblay, certain effects are already being felt.
